Subject: Re: [HP3000-L] FTP Hangs to Europe
One cause that we can clearly point to is that 5.5 does not support
passive mode FTP and the new MPLS installed in Italy either does not
support or was not configured to support active mode FTP. Sounds like
an easy enough configuration change. But, other than security
administration, this particular network team is pretty hands off.
Apparently, they outsource the equipment installs to an outside
provider. And they are quite happy pointing the finger at an OS that is
15 (+/-) years old.
As Lars pointed out, this only addresses FTP and not TELNET or VT-MGR.
These issues are most likely firewall related as the new company in
Italy employs a very conservative security scheme.
It's likely that we'll need to upgrade, if only to remove a reason for
the network people to stop trying to fix the network.
